Title: How Long Will $2 Million Last in Retirement Across All U.S. States? A Comprehensive Guide
Content:
Introduction to Retirement Planning with $2 Million
Retirement planning is a critical aspect of financial security, and understanding how long your savings will last is paramount. If you have $2 million in retirement savings, you might wonder how far it can take you in different states across the U.S. This article delves into the specifics of how long $2 million can sustain you in each state, considering factors like cost of living, taxes, and healthcare expenses. Let's explore the nuances of retirement planning and see how your $2 million can be maximized.
Understanding the Variables: Cost of Living, Taxes, and Healthcare
Before we dive into state-specific data, it's essential to understand the variables that affect how long your retirement savings will last. The three primary factors are:
- Cost of Living: This varies significantly across states and even within regions. Higher costs mean your savings will deplete faster.
- Taxes: State income taxes, property taxes, and sales taxes can impact your disposable income in retirement.
- Healthcare: As you age, healthcare costs can increase, affecting your retirement budget.
How Long Will $2 Million Last in Each State?
Northeastern States
New York
In New York, particularly in cities like New York City, the cost of living is high. With state income taxes and substantial healthcare costs, $2 million might last around 15-18 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 139.1
- Effective State Tax Rate: 6.47%
- Estimated Duration: 15-18 years
Massachusetts
Massachusetts has a high cost of living and state income taxes, but efficient healthcare systems can help stretch your dollar. Here, $2 million could last approximately 17-20 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 134.7
- Effective State Tax Rate: 5.08%
- Estimated Duration: 17-20 years
Southern States
Florida
Florida is known for its lack of state income tax, which can significantly extend the life of your retirement savings. With a moderate cost of living, $2 million could last around 22-25 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 102.8
- Effective State Tax Rate: 0%
- Estimated Duration: 22-25 years
Texas
Texas, another state with no income tax, offers a lower cost of living compared to many other states. Here, $2 million might last 23-26 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 93.9
- Effective State Tax Rate: 0%
- Estimated Duration: 23-26 years
Western States
California
California's high cost of living and state income taxes can quickly deplete retirement savings. In this state, $2 million might last around 14-17 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 149.9
- Effective State Tax Rate: 9.3%
- Estimated Duration: 14-17 years
Colorado
Colorado offers a moderate cost of living and a favorable tax environment. Here, $2 million could last approximately 19-22 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 105.6
- Effective State Tax Rate: 4.63%
- Estimated Duration: 19-22 years
Midwestern States
Illinois
Illinois has a high cost of living in urban areas like Chicago, but lower costs in rural areas. With state income taxes, $2 million might last around 18-21 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 93.4
- Effective State Tax Rate: 5.00%
- Estimated Duration: 18-21 years
Ohio
Ohio offers a lower cost of living and moderate state taxes, making it a favorable state for retirement. Here, $2 million could last approximately 21-24 years.
- Cost of Living Index: 92.7
- Effective State Tax Rate: 3.99%
- Estimated Duration: 21-24 years
Strategies to Maximize Your $2 Million in Retirement
Invest Wisely
Investing your retirement savings wisely can help extend their lifespan. Consider a diversified portfolio that includes stocks, bonds, and real estate investments.
Consider Relocating
If you're flexible about where you live, consider moving to a state with a lower cost of living and favorable tax environment. States like Florida and Texas are popular choices for retirees.
Plan for Healthcare Costs
Healthcare costs can be a significant expense in retirement. Consider purchasing long-term care insurance or moving to a state with lower healthcare costs.
Budget and Monitor Expenses
Regularly review your budget and monitor your expenses to ensure you're not overspending. Use financial planning tools to track your spending and adjust as needed.
